npm package version OPENSSL_1_1_1e required error

adorobis

Dabbler
Joined
Oct 16, 2017
Messages
27
Hello,
After installing node in jail (12.2-RELEASE-p4) I can't use it as always throws the following error:
Code:
ld-elf.so.1: /lib/libcrypto.so.111: version OPENSSL_1_1_1e required by /usr/local/bin/node not found

Any idea how to solve it? I could not find solution here in forums neither on freebsd forums.
 

Samuel Tai

Never underestimate your own stupidity
Moderator
Joined
Apr 24, 2020
Messages
5,399
Have you tried pkg update, followed by pkg upgrade openssl inside the jail?
 

adorobis

Dabbler
Joined
Oct 16, 2017
Messages
27
I already have newer openssl version - which is part of the os. pkg upgrade also shows it is the up to date package.
# openssl version OpenSSL 1.1.1h-freebsd 22 Sep 2020
So to me it looks like node is not recognizing the newer version or it has a hard dependency on the 1.1.1e one.
 

sretalla

Powered by Neutrality
Moderator
Joined
Jan 1, 2016
Messages
9,703
Top